N-VA, the New Flemish Alliance, is a Flemish nationalist political party in Belgium. The party’s ideology is rooted in Flemish nationalism, which seeks to promote the cultural and political autonomy of Flanders, the Dutch-speaking region of Belgium.

Historical and Ideological Connections

N-VA’s roots can be traced back to the Flemish Movement, a political and cultural movement that emerged in the 19th century. The movement advocated for the recognition of the Flemish language and culture and for greater autonomy for Flanders within Belgium.

N-VA was founded in 2001 by former members of the Christian Democratic and Flemish Alliance (CD&V). The party’s ideology is based on the principles of Flemish nationalism, which includes a belief in the distinct identity of the Flemish people and a desire for greater autonomy for Flanders.

Promoting Flemish Cultural Identity and Autonomy

N-VA has played a significant role in promoting Flemish cultural identity and autonomy. The party has supported policies that promote the use of the Flemish language in education, government, and the media. N-VA has also advocated for greater economic and political autonomy for Flanders, including the right to self-determination.

N-VA’s Impact on Belgian Politics

N-VA, the New Flemish Alliance, has had a significant impact on Belgian politics since its foundation in 2001. The party has played a key role in shaping government policies and has had a major influence on the political landscape.

N-VA’s Role in Government

N-VA has been part of the Belgian government since 2011. During this time, the party has had a major influence on government policies, particularly in the areas of immigration, education, and healthcare. N-VA has also played a key role in the negotiations over the future of Belgium, including the issue of Flemish independence.

N-VA’s Impact on the Political Landscape

N-VA’s presence in Belgian politics has had a major impact on the political landscape. The party has helped to legitimize the Flemish nationalist movement and has made it more difficult for other parties to ignore the issue of Flemish independence.

N-VA has also contributed to the polarization of Belgian politics, with the party’s opponents often accusing it of being racist and xenophobic.
